How to fill out invitation to bid

How to fill out an invitation to bid:
01
Start by clearly identifying the project: Provide a brief and descriptive title or name for the project at the top of the invitation to bid. Include any relevant project numbers or identifiers.
02
Provide detailed project information: Include a clear and comprehensive description of the project, including the scope of work, specifications, and any other relevant details. This will enable bidders to understand the requirements and submit accurate bids.
03
Specify the bid submission requirements: Clearly state the deadline for bid submissions and the acceptable methods of submission (e.g., in person, by mail, online). Include any specific formatting or document requirements, such as bid forms or attachments that bidders need to complete and submit.
04
Include a bid bond requirement (if applicable): If a bid bond is required, clearly specify the amount and provide instructions on how bidders can obtain and submit the bond. A bid bond can provide assurance to the project owner that the bidder is financially capable to perform the work.
05
Provide instructions for bid evaluation: Let bidders know the criteria that will be used to evaluate their bids. Specify if there are any preferences for certain qualifications, experience, or references. Also, mention any specific requirements for subcontracting or partnering.
06
Clarify questions and communication: Specify a designated contact person for any questions or clarifications regarding the invitation to bid. Provide their contact information, including email address and phone number. Also, mention if and when any communication or addenda will be issued to all interested bidders.
Who needs an invitation to bid?
01
Contractors and Vendors: Companies or individuals who provide goods, services, or construction work can benefit from an invitation to bid. They need to receive an invitation to have the opportunity to compete for project contracts.
02
Government Agencies: Public bodies, such as federal, state, or local government agencies, often use invitations to bid when they require services, supplies, or construction for their projects.
03
Private Organizations: Private companies or organizations that require specific services, supplies, or construction work for their projects can also issue invitations to bid. This allows them to assess different bids and select the most suitable contractor or vendor for their needs.
In summary, filling out an invitation to bid involves clearly identifying the project, providing detailed project information, specifying bid submission requirements, including a bid bond requirement if necessary, providing bid evaluation instructions, and clarifying questions and communication. Contractors, vendors, government agencies, and private organizations typically need invitations to bid to find suitable contractors or vendors for their projects.

What is invitation to bid?
Invitation to bid is a formal request for vendors to submit a proposal to provide goods or services.
Who is required to file invitation to bid?
Government agencies, organizations, or businesses looking to procure goods or services through a competitive bidding process are required to file invitation to bid.
How to fill out invitation to bid?
To fill out an invitation to bid, one must include details about the project, specifications, terms and conditions, deadline for submission, and any other relevant information.
What is the purpose of invitation to bid?
The purpose of invitation to bid is to ensure fair competition among vendors, achieve the best value for goods or services, and promote transparency in the procurement process.
What information must be reported on invitation to bid?
Information such as project details, specifications, terms and conditions, submission deadline, contact information, and any other relevant information must be reported on invitation to bid.
